1. Batching reduces decision fatigue
If you’ve ever stared at your phone thinking “what the heck should I post?”, you’re not alone.
Batching helps because:
You make fewer decisions in the moment
You remove the “ugh I should post” pressure from your day
You already have content ready to go when things get hectic
Less thinking. More doing. Fewer brain spirals.

2. You create better content (with less stress)
When you’re not racing to write captions at red lights or filming Reels while your lunch is microwaving, your content feels different. It’s clearer. More aligned. Less rushed.
Batching gives you space to:
Think through your message
Keep your brand voice consistent
Avoid the “just post something” panic

4. You stay consistent without losing your mind
Consistency doesn’t mean showing up every day without fail.
It means having a plan—and sticking to it most of the time.
Batching helps you:
Stick to your pillars
Keep momentum during your busy weeks
Build trust with your audience because they see you
Spoiler: that’s where the growth happens.
